Output 70e56fd65b9f060635c3b0add797533170a12066e937ccdabc12bd304f60ea5a:2

value
80816049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50a9aa6d5c2dbf8dd28fbcdfe232f5a84ab08a65 OP_EQUAL
address
MFFfYMjYy65xzNCj3xAoxHPxob3TsE45Qt
transaction
70e56fd65b9f060635c3b0add797533170a12066e937ccdabc12bd304f60ea5a
spent
true